The Yorkshire Evening Post claim Joe Gelhardt is in ‘advanced talks’ over signing a new contract at Leeds United – with an announcement expected for the striker next week, after a whirlwind first season at senior level.
Gelhardt, 20, scored 18 goals in 28 games for the club’s Premier League 2 side and it saw Marcelo Bielsa hand the ex-Wigan man a debut in the first half of the season. He went on to play 22 times in all competitions.

Of those 22, 20 came in the Premier League – having a hand in six goals; scoring a crucial injury-time winner against Norwich City. He also laid on a stunning assist against Brighton, saving a point and draw 1-1 at Elland Road.
Now, Gelhardt is due to be rewarded. His current deal ends in 2024 but that has not stopped the likes of Kalvin Phillips and Raphinha departing. A player, that Brenden Aaronson branded both “amazing” and “exciting”.
Gelhardt in advanced talks over signing new Leeds contract
The YEP state that a deal could be announced as early as next week. He is expected to be the first of a string of new deals at Elland Road. The report also states that Cryenscio Summerville will come next, with Forest interested.
It is an intriguing summer for Gelhardt. Patrick Bamford is due to return from injury. Plagued by injury last season, the England international is likely to remain first choice. Rodrigo has also been playing up top.
Meanwhile, Leeds are likely to be looking at a new signing in terms of bringing in a striker. There was interest in Eddie Nketiah before he signed a new deal at Arsenal. But Gelhardt is set to sign a new deal.
